Guidelines for Improving Web Page Scannability

In the fast-paced digital age, web users often skim through content rather than reading it in-depth. To ensure that your web pages are easily scannable and that important information is readily accessible, it is crucial to follow certain guidelines. Implementing the following practices will enhance the scannability of your web pages:

1. Use Headings to Summarize Topics:
Similar to the structure of this book, utilize headings and subheadings to summarize the main topics of your web page. These headings act as signposts, allowing users to quickly identify the sections that interest them. Clear headings facilitate efficient scanning of your content.

2. Use Lists:
Lists are highly effective for presenting information in a concise and organized manner. Whenever you have related items to summarize, consider using ordered or unordered lists. For example, if you need to outline steps or highlight key features, structuring the content as a list improves scannability.

3. Include Link Menus:
Link menus serve as a type of list and offer the same advantages in terms of scannability. They not only enhance the visual appeal of your web page but also serve as a useful navigation tool. Incorporate link menus to aid users in quickly finding the desired information or accessing various sections of your website.

4. Avoid Burying Important Information:
When conveying important points or critical information, avoid burying them within lengthy paragraphs or at the bottom of the page. Instead, prioritize the placement of vital information by presenting it close to the top of the page or at the beginning of paragraphs. This ensures that users encounter the crucial content without having to sift through excessive text.

5. Write Short, Clear Paragraphs:
Long paragraphs can deter readers from engaging with your content. To improve scannability, keep paragraphs concise and focused. Breaking down text into shorter paragraphs makes it easier to read and enables users to quickly glean the information they seek. Remember, the farther into a paragraph your main point is, the less likely it is to be read.

By adhering to these guidelines, you can enhance the scannability of your web pages, making it easier for users to find relevant information quickly. By utilizing headings, lists, link menus, prioritizing important content, and writing clear paragraphs, you create a user-friendly experience that encourages engagement with your web content.
